Transaction 06f1662c40965731fe0f66b49e44372ecc2ee8be8e41c2b1fc8895a27239ef25

block
4ae908d649b597b22681cd108ac88c00d69b1481868f7ed8c0e0540c0181575a

1 Input

3 Outputs